Contracts Administrator - Construction jobs in New York

Contracts Administrator - Construction assists in the preparation, review, and administration of contractual proposals relating to construction projects. Responsible for preparing bids and negotiating specifications for materials, equipment, manpower, or other construction services. Being a Contracts Administrator - Construction secures all necessary approvals and ensures that standard company procedures are followed. Typically requires a bachelor's degree. Additionally, Contracts Administrator - Construction typically reports to a supervisor or manager. To be a Contracts Administrator - Construction typically requires 0 to 2 years of related experience. Works on projects/matters of limited complexity in a support role. Work is closely managed.     About the Role:

    The contracts administrator position will encompass and support all aspects of state and federal contracts and subcontracts for the organization. This role supports the life cycle of the contracting process – from assisting with the preparation of proposal responses to providing support to project teams and the finance department, conducting negotiations with subcontractors and other partners, administering contracts and subcontracts, providing compliance reporting, and maintaining contract and subcontract documentation (including processing contract modifications and change orders).

    Key Responsibilities

    • Draft various levels of contract/subcontract documents in accordance with applicable NYSTEC policies, procedures, practices, and/or guidelines.
    • Provide contract summaries and ensure that contract execution is in accordance with company policy.
    • Support the development, negotiation, and award of subcontracts and other business agreements (teaming, nondisclosure, confidentiality).
    • Monitor and ensure compliance with legal requirements, contract specifications (including minority and women-owned business enterprise [MWBE] participation and reporting), and government/client regulations.
    • Prepare and administer routine correspondence and other contract/subcontract related documentation.
    • Prepare, organize, and maintain contract and subcontract records and files documenting performance and compliance.
    • Educate internal clients to improve processes and to ensure effective contracting practices.
    • Attend meetings with visiting clients to review and resolve any problems or misunderstandings regarding the contract and to strengthen business relationships.
    • Establish and maintain regular written and in-person communications with stakeholders regarding pertinent contract and subcontract needs.
    • Prepare other contract reporting/compliance documentation, as needed.

New York is a state in the Northeastern United States. New York was one of the original thirteen colonies that formed the United States. New York covers 54,555 square miles (141,300 km2) and ranks as the 27th largest state by size.[3] The highest elevation in New York is Mount Marcy in the Adirondacks, at 5,344 feet (1,629 meters) above sea level; while the state's lowest point is at sea level, on the Atlantic Ocean.
